WOODS MAINTENANCE CLEANING MACHINE Clean the machine after use Compressed air is recommended Do not use a pressure washer The machine will run cooler and last longer if kept free of clippings and other debris A clean machine also re duces the risk of fire due to accumulation of combus tible debris and chaff Brush or blow clippings and debris off the cutterdeck and engine deck DO NOT use a pressure washer WASHING MACHINE CAUTION Improperly washing a machine can cause water to enter bearings and other components This can greatly reduce component life Do not use a pressure washer Do not direct water at bearings or seals High pressure water can blow past seals and enter sealed bearings Allow the machine to cool down before washing Water on a warm machine can be sucked into sealed bearings as they cool Avoid getting electrical connections wet Water can cause electrical faults and corrosion of elec trical components 15 MAINTENANCE WOODS BLADE REMOVAL Follow these instructions to prevent injury during blade removal 1 Loosen with a box wrench or a socket and long breaker bar To gain additional leverage slip a long pipe or thick walled tube over breaker bar or wrench Insert wood block as shown with grain perpendicular to blade to prevent blade from turning when loosening Wear thickly padded gloves Keep hands clear of blade path Blades may rotate when

17. bolt releases SHARPENING Blades may be sharpened by filing or grinding Inspect blades before sharpening Replace bent or cracked blades Replace blades when the lift portion has worn thin Maintain cut angle at 30 Do not overheat blades when sharpening Always use BOB CAT blades Use of another manufacturer s blades may be dangerous BELTS All belts are tensioned by spring loaded idlers No adjustment is required 16 BLADE BALANCE Blade balance must be maintained at 5 8 oz in 19 4 g cm or less Failure to keep blades balanced causes excess vibration wear and shortened life of most components of the machine To balance a blade 1 2 3 Sharpen blade first Balance the blade at the center Attach a 1 8 oz 3 9 g weight at a distance 5 127 mm from center on the light end This should make the light end the heavy end If it does the blade is balanced f does not file or grind the heavy end until the addition of the weight makes the light end the heavy end BLADE INSTALLATION Wear thickly padded gloves to prevent cuts from the sharp blade Insert the blade bolt in order through the conical washer cup side toward the blade as shown the blade and the blade spacer Install assembly on the blade spindle Torque the blade bolt to 70 ft lbs IS ADJUSTMENTS DECK LEVELING Park the machine on a smooth level surface Raise the deck to the transport posit

30. aks To check remove reservoir cap M The fluid level should be at the bottom of the filler tube If low top up do not overfill Use one of the oils listed below SAE 15W40 motor oil SAE 20W50 motor oil 15W50 synthetic motor oil AFTER FIRST FIVE 5 HOURS 1 Remove plug N to drain hydraulic reservoir Dis pose of used oil in accordance with local require ments Clean and replace the plug Change hydraulic oil filter G Fill the reservoir with fresh oil to the bottom of the reservoir filler tube using an oil from the list above Do not overfill PERIODIC OIL CHANGES Change the hydraulic fluid and hydraulic filter after each 500 hours of operation using the same procedure given above NOTES Before servicing the hydraulic system stop the engine View from below machine disconnect spark plug wires and disengage the PTO After any hydraulic line is opened plug or cap it promptly to reduce the risk of contamination Do not use sealant tape on hydraulic pipe fittings Use a liquid sealant that will dissolve into the system Make sure all hydraulic connections are tight and hydraulic hoses and lines are in good condition before applying pressure to system 44 WARNING The machine s hydraulic system operates under high pressure When checking for leaks do not use your hands to attempt to find a leak Instead use card board or paper Escaping hydraulic fluid can be under sufficient pressure to

38. ion Good operating conditions are indicated if the plug has a light coating of grey or tan deposit A white blistered coating indicates overheating A black coating indicates an over rich fuel mixture Both may be caused by a clogged air cleaner or improper carburetor adjustment Do not sandblast wire brush or otherwise attempt to repair a plug in poor condition Best results are obtained with a new plug Set plug gap as specified in engine manual 13 MAINTENANCE WOODS FUEL FILTER An inline fuel filter is located in the fuel supply line Inspect at every oil change to make sure it is clean and unobstructed Replace if dirty ENGINE COOLING Continued operation with a clogged cooling system will cause severe overheating and can result in en gine damage Daily Clean air intake screen S on air cooled engines and T on liquid cooled engines Every 100 hours Clean cooling fins beneath blower housing H with reference to information in the engine manufacturer s manual HEAVY DUTY CYCLONIC AIR CLEANER Clean and replace the air cleaner element as specified in the service chart Uneven running lack of power or black exhaust fumes may indicate a dirty air cleaner To replace air cleaner elements 1 Unclamp end cover X and remove existing cleaner elements Insert new elements Y and Z and replace cover Ensure the breathing port A is pointing down and towards the front of the tractor 14

45. penetrate skin and cause serious injury If hydraulic fluid is injected into the skin it must be promptly removed by a doctor familiar with this form of injury or gangrene may result 12 MAINTENANCE WOODS ENGINE OIL Do not perform engine maintenance without the engine off spark plug wires disconnected and PTO disengaged AFTER FIRST FIVE 5 HOURS While the engine is warm 1 Release the oil drain hose assembly from the engine clip J Lay hose assembly over the frame edge Remove the rubber cap D from the tip of the hose assembly and turn the drain valve to allow oil to drain from the engine Dispose of used oil in accordance with local requirements Clean drain valve and tighten the plastic portion of the drain valve back into the metal portion of the valve Replace rubber cap over the tip of the valve Replace hose assembly back into engine clip Change oil filter Fill the crankcase with fresh oil to the full mark Do not overfill See engine manual for oil specifications PERIODIC OIL CHANGES DAILY 1 engine manual for oil and filter change inter Check oil level with the dipstick vals after the break in period If oil is needed add fresh oil of proper 2 Follow instructions for first oil change above viscosity and grade See engine manual for oil specifications Do not overfill Replace dipstick before starting engine SPARK PLUGS Remove each plug and check condit
